Akeem Olujinmi Lawal is a founding management team member of Interswitch Group since 2002, currently serving as Divisional Chief Executive Officer of Payments Infrastructure and Processing. With over 26 years of experience in electronic payments, payments technology, strategy, and business management, he leads the division responsible for approximately half of the group's revenue. He headed the engineering team that built the InterSwitch Super Switch infrastructure and is co-founder of Africa's first fintech unicorn. Prior to Interswitch, he worked with Oildata Services in Port Harcourt and TELNET as a Senior Engineer. He is a member of the Governing Council of the Fintech Association of Nigeria, an Archbishop Desmond Tutu Fellow of the African Leadership Institute, and a believer in the intelligent use of technology for Africa's transformation.
